A Child's Fate Ended While Playing

When I was immersed in evening prayers
Lighting the lamp and inscence
Uttering a few words that
God let all souls rest in peace
Give peace and harmony to the living...
I heard a thunderous sound
Next to my wall, thinking that
Somebody would have banged their door
But my mind was telling to open the door
Did so, my god! ! shocked to see a child
In the basement in a pool of blood...
Felt a sudden numbness and was speechless
Within a minute the whole apartment
Children and ladies screaming and rushing
The hopeless mother lifted the child
Immediately rushed to the hospital
But confessed as brought dead
As the children were playing
Hide and seek this boy, slipped
From the fourth floor to the basement
Through the staircase gap....
Lost his breathe on the spot.
Nobody knows where our fate hangs
How we die......
